Output 0b8c3ff33c1d85fe690c8f75f0a6a672282a3b2eee33a169dabc5ebde406b384:0

value
5133518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d1898173e3bb34f726c51891eb8dac342b42e78 OP_EQUAL
address
3EZ4fRKnHNCXnjSEUDGCZ8H4jaNcWuaPRT
transaction
0b8c3ff33c1d85fe690c8f75f0a6a672282a3b2eee33a169dabc5ebde406b384
confirmations
283687
spent
true